I recently underwent a total knee replacement in October, this is the second procedure I have had in this hospital this year (hip replacement in March). I couldn't fault the staff or the service either time. I was surprised to read a review referring to the fact that the staff treat NHS patients like second class citizens. On neither occasion was the fact I was an NHS patient even mentioned. Everyone from the consultant to the housekeeping staff was pleasant, courteous and helpful. When I had a couple of troublesome nights and apologised to the night staff for needing attention, they were at pains to put me at my ease and assured me that "This was what we are here for". In the last few years I have accompanied & visited both my husband and mother in various NHS hospitals around the district so I am able to make informed comparisons and Yorkshire Clinic is head and shoulders above the best of the rest. I would dread having to go into one of the other local hospitals now.
